Output dfea02bbd55f84644a495d24ea7ca83226409793c5924554cd5590ad860bda93:0

value
156932981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375eb3b6ded33ae1828b9cf8fc7939459f301 OP_EQUAL
address
3BMEXdHYWNA6XVaq1EFmrBoCQyUiJnfGjG
transaction
dfea02bbd55f84644a495d24ea7ca83226409793c5924554cd5590ad860bda93
spent
true